We study exclusive non-leptonic two-body Bc→(D(s),ηc,B(s))+F
decays with F(pseudoscalar or vector meson) being factored out in QCD
factorization approach. The non-leptonic decay amplitudes are related to the
product of meson decay constants and the form factors for semileptonic Bc
decays. As inputs in obtaining the branching ratios for a large set of
non-leptonic Bc decays, we use the weak form factors for the semileptonic
Bc→(D(s),ηc,B(s)) decays in the whole kinematical region and the
unmeasured meson decay constants obtained from our previous light-front quark
model. We compare our results of the branching ratios with those of other
theoretical studies.Comment: 11 pages, 3 figures, minor corrections, version to appear in PR
